KCl is comparable to NaCl, but not as well known. Our decision around NaCl for fundamental cell material as it is significantly less hygroscopic, transmits further more to the infrared vary, and resists thermal shock.

Interferometer. It contains the interferometer, the beam splitter, the fixed mirror and the going mirror. The beam read more splittertakes the incoming infrared beam and divides it into two optical beams. One beam displays off the fastened mirror. Another beam reflects off on the moving mirror which moves an exceedingly quick distance.
